如何监控和优化好用的云服务器性能,提高运行效率?

云服务器作为一种新型的计算模式,因其按需使用、易于扩展等优点受到越来越多企业的青睐。为了确保应用程序能够稳定、高效地运行,我们需要对云服务器的性能进行持续的监控和优化。

如何监控和优化好用的云服务器性能,提高运行效率?

一、云服务器性能监控

1. 选择合适的监控工具

在选择监控工具时,应根据业务需求来确定需要监控的内容,如CPU使用率、内存占用情况、磁盘I/O、网络带宽等。除了云服务商自带的监控工具外,我们还可以借助Prometheus+Grafana等开源工具实现自定义监控。

2. 设置报警机制

当资源使用率超过设定阈值或发生异常时,系统会及时发送告警信息,以便管理员可以快速响应并解决问题。报警机制的设置有助于防止因突发流量导致的服务器宕机问题。

3. 分析历史数据

通过对历史数据的分析,我们可以找出影响性能的关键因素,并据此调整配置或优化代码。这可以帮助我们更好地理解应用的性能瓶颈,从而为后续的优化提供参考。

二、云服务器性能优化

1. 资源分配

根据业务类型和负载特点合理分配CPU、内存、磁盘空间等资源,避免出现资源浪费或不足的情况。例如,在处理大量并发请求时,可以适当增加CPU核心数;对于数据密集型任务,则需要预留足够大的存储空间。

2. 应用程序优化

通过分析日志文件、性能报告等方式定位到耗时较长的操作,进而优化数据库查询语句、减少不必要的HTTP请求、压缩传输内容等。还可以考虑采用缓存技术(如Redis)来加速静态资源加载速度。

3. 网络优化

尽量选择靠近用户所在地区的数据中心部署实例,这样可以降低延迟时间;同时也要保证网络安全,防止遭受DDoS攻击等恶意行为的影响。

4. 定期维护

定期检查硬件状态、清理垃圾文件、更新操作系统补丁等操作都有助于保持服务器处于最佳工作状态。随着业务的发展和技术的进步,我们还需要不断学习新的知识,尝试引入更先进的架构设计思路。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/58167.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 2025年1月17日 下午10:10
下一篇 2025年1月17日 下午10:10

相关推荐

  • 云服务器电信动态IP环境下,邮件服务的配置与优化

    在当今数字化时代,电子邮件作为企业、组织和个人之间沟通的重要工具,其稳定性和安全性至关重要。在使用云服务器提供的邮件服务时,由于电信运营商分配的是动态IP地址,这可能会对邮件发送和接收产生影响。为了确保邮件服务的正常运行,有必要进行一些特定的配置和优化。 一、动态IP对邮件服务的影响 当我们在云服务器上部署邮件系统时,如果使用的网络环境是基于动态IP的,则意…

    2025年1月17日
    800
  • 百度云盘服务器空间不足?教你几招轻松扩容!

    在数字时代,随着我们日常生活中文件的不断增加,对存储空间的需求也越来越大。百度网盘作为一款广泛使用的云端存储服务,为我们提供了便捷的文件管理方式。当遇到“百度云盘服务器空间不足”的提示时,你是否会感到困扰呢?别担心,今天就来教大家几招,轻松解决这个问题。 一、合理利用已有的免费空间 1. 清理无用文件 检查一下自己的百度云盘中是否有不再需要的文件,如过期的照…

    2025年1月18日
    800
  • 在阿里云服务器上搭建网站,域名解析该怎么做?

    随着互联网的迅猛发展,越来越多的企业和个人选择将业务搬上网络。而阿里云作为国内领先的云计算服务提供商,凭借其稳定可靠的服务和丰富的功能模块,成为众多用户的首选。本文将详细介绍如何在阿里云服务器上进行域名解析以成功搭建自己的网站。 一、购买域名与服务器 您需要拥有一个可用的域名以及一台阿里云ECS(Elastic Compute Service)实例。如果您还…

    2025年1月17日
    800
  • 选择云服务器时,如何确保其具备高级别的安全防护能力?

    在选择云服务器时,首先要考察其安全防护能力。这需要查看云服务器提供商是否具备完善的安全资质和合规认证,如ISO 27001(信息安全管理体系)、ISO 27018(公有云个人可识别信息信息安全管理体系)等国际权威认证。 这些认证表明云服务商遵循严格的管理标准,拥有强大的技术实力,在数据处理方面具有安全性,能够确保企业数据资产的安全。还需注意该云服务提供商是否…

    2025年1月18日
    700
  • Linux云服务器登录后无法执行命令的原因及解决办法有哪些?

    在使用Linux云服务器时,有时会出现登录后无法执行命令的情况。这可能是由于多种原因造成的,包括权限问题、环境变量配置错误、网络连接问题等。本文将探讨一些常见的原因及其对应的解决方案。 1. 权限不足 原因: 如果用户没有足够的权限来执行某些命令,可能会导致命令无法运行。例如,普通用户尝试执行需要root权限的命令时,就会遇到权限不足的问题。 解决办法: 确…

    2025年1月17日
    900

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部